# Stubi Karenz Übergabe Wie kannst du mich erreichen? - im Notfall: Signal (privat) - sonst: Teams oder Email (@ait.ac.at) 1.12.2021 bis 31.1.2022: ich werde Teams/Emails *nicht* checken, wenn was dringendes ist -> Signal ab 1.2.2022: ein Arbeitstag pro Woche, d.h. ich werde regelmäßig Teams/Emails lesen ## MyTrips > mstubenschrott, cseragiotto (Ariadne) Ursprünglich war in *CARBON DIET* bzw *MyFairShare* (in beiden Fällen Alex + Christian als Ansprechpartner) etwas vorgesehen, sieht derzeit aber nicht mehr danach aus. ### AIT Mobilitätsumfrage Aufbauend auf den Ergebnissen von MyTrips soll ein Umfragetool zur Mobilität am AIT entwickelt werden. - Code in https://gitlab-intern.ait.ac.at/energy/commons/mytrips Offene Fragen: - Keine backups in /opt/backups am server? - Mehrere sites für eine person? - *Einfache* möglichkeit ariadne routen testen zu können (thomas) - Wie diaryjs_lib debuggen ohne immer neu local zu deployen? - arrival time in Ariadne routing? #### TODOs/Next steps - GTFS Verändern anschauen (Thomas): gtfs.zip erstellen für Shuttle Seibersdorf - Localization - Dienstreise: Routen als Ariadne-JSON (Thomas) ## sysadmin Du bist nun Admin für diese Server (wo sonst ich Hauptadmin bin): - birdperson (OpenVPN, wird benutzt von den wifiscannern) - demeter ([compute cluster](https://gitlab-intern.ait.ac.at/wiki/wiki/-/wikis/knowledge_domains/compute_cluster) für MATSim-Berechnungen) (I like simsaev so much, I like simsaev so much!) - glootie (GTFS Editor, evtl. auch für MATSim) - meeseek (GitLab-Group-Runner für die Energy-Gruppe) - meeseek2 (-"-) - mytrips.ait.ac.at - nexus.ait.ac.at Ad compute-cluster: für MATSim-Läufe so einloggen: `ssh matsim@10.101.251.83` Siehe [Servertabelle](https://gitlab-intern.ait.ac.at/wiki/wiki/-/wikis/sysadmin/server_table) für IPs und weitere Admins - teilweise kannst du auch Hannes fragen :) ## MATSim > Das wird der Hauptpunkt bei dem du mich bitte vertreten musst Offizielle Doku zum Einlesen/Skimmen: https://matsim.org/docs/userguide Wer spielt mit: Gerald (popsyn), Johannes (simuliert), Paul (PL+air mobility), Christian (subpopulations/mode choice) ### SHOW Simulationen macht Johannes, Modell ist bereits fertig, wahrscheinlich nichts mehr zu tun. ### Urban Air Mobility (Paul) Simulationen macht Paul, Simulationsstart 2021-11 (mit MATSim 12!) ..irgendwas mit air mobility simulieren ### DOMINO Simulationen starten 2021-12, noch viel zu tun! - 2 von 3 Modellen müssen noch gemacht werden (OÖ + Wien) - .. aber das schafft Markus evtl. noch zum Großteil :) - Mitfahrgelegenheiten simulieren (Änderungen im Java-Code nötig!) ### [matsim-salabim](https://gitlab-intern.ait.ac.at/energy/commons/matsim-salabim) > in Produktion, eine alte lauffähige Version für MATSim 12, eine aktuelle Version für MATSim 13 **Szenario erstellen** Viel Arbeit, genau dokumentiert hier: https://gitlab-intern.ait.ac.at/energy/commons/matsim-salabim/-/tree/master/data_preparation Fertige Szenarien liegen am Cluster bzw. auf `V:\mobility_data_dts\data\MATSim\models` **Was ist die salabim-magic?** Hier wirds erklärt (im README vom Java-Projekt = Main) https://gitlab-intern.ait.ac.at/energy/commons/matsim-salabim/-/tree/master/simulation/matsim-salabim Es gibt ein eingechecktes kleines Beispielszenario (praktisch zum Testen) https://gitlab-intern.ait.ac.at/energy/commons/matsim-salabim/-/tree/master/simulation/matsim-salabim/src/main/resources/scenarios/floridsdorf Laufen lassen im Eclipse: Main.java mit - working directory: ${workspace_loc:matsim-salabim/src/main/resources} - program arguments: runSimulation -c scenarios/floridsdorf/config_vanilla.xml -o /tmp/matsim_output_vanilla - pfade im config.xml sind relativ zu sich selbst **Szenario laufen lassen** [So läuft's am Cluster](https://gitlab-intern.ait.ac.at/energy/commons/matsim-salabim/-/tree/master/simulation/cluster_scripts) ### [matsim-salapym](https://gitlab-intern.ait.ac.at/energy/commons/matsim-salapym) > allgemeine python-Tools - dieses Projekt ist ganz am Anfang der Entwicklung! Ziele: - **Wiederverwendbare *Analysepipeline*** von MATSim-Simulationsläufen - Input = Ordner mit MATSim-Simulationsergebnissen - Output = ... z.B. Modal Split-Veränderungen, Emissionen,.. (Use Cases werden gerade definiert) - alte matsim-tools-dts (v.a. IO von MATSim-Input&Output) aus matsim-salabim sollen hierher migriert werden (refactoring + tests nötig) > Entwicklung: startet ab 2021-11, Hauptentwickler Gerald + Johannes